POSITION

The Scope Society of Alberta is seeking a full-time Triple P Practitioner with experience providing support to families raising children with special needs.

RESPONSIBILITIES

The successful candidate will be working directly with parents/guardians remotely (over phone or Microsoft Teams) providing strategies to assist families in reaching their behavioural and developmentalgoals.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Work directly with approximately 18 families each week over phone or Microsoft Teams.
  • Gather individualized and comprehensive information on each client served.
  • Facilitate delivery of curriculum-based Triple P programs with parents/caregivers.
  • Help parents/caregivers identify strategies that fit their needs and thereby increase their competence and confidence.
  • Deliver assessment results review tracking and causes of behavior.
  • Complete administrative tasks according to required procedures.
  • Ensure client files are accurate and current.
  • Actively participate in team meetings reflective practices wellness meetings team building activities and external meetings.
  • Support other team members by sharing resources information ideas and projects as needed.
  • Liaise and work collaboratively with other agencies and professionals.
  • This position requires the ability to work flextime.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

  • Bachelors Degree in Human Services (Community Rehabilitation Social Work Psychology or related discipline) and a minimum of two years experience or an equivalent combination of experience and education.
  • Triple P is an accredited position requiring specialized training which will be provided.
  • Experience working with children with disabilities and their families.
  • Valid drivers license and vehicle with appropriate insurance coverage.
